THE 17 AUGUST 1999 GOELCUEK (KOCAELI)- ARIFIYE (ADAPAZARI) AND 12 NOVEMBER 1999 DUEZCE EARTHQUAKES, NW TURKEY: THEIR MECHANISMS AND TECTONIC SIGNIFICANCE

摘要

17 August 1999 Goelcuek (Kocaeli)-Arifiye (Adapazan) earthquake (Mw=7.4) occurred along the western part of the North Anatolian Fault Zone. The earthquake was centered at 40.702°N, 29.987°E and originated at a depth of 17 km. The earthquake created a 160 km long surface rupture in a right-lateral sense of shear and exhibits two large displacements at two geographic locations that are about 70 km apart. The displacements are 4.1 m at Goelcuek and 4.9 m in the south of Arifiye. An inversion analysis of seismic data suggests a two-stage fracturing. 12 November Duezce earthquake (Mw=7.1) occurred to the east of Goelcuek-Arifiye line and created a 38 km long surface rupture. The maximum rigth-lateral displacement of 4.5 m occurred in the middle of the surface rupture. To the south of Duezce, the surface ruptures of two earthquakes overlapped by about 10 km length. Duezce earthquake must have been triggered by Goelcuek-Arifiye earthquake.
